Understanding Tequila

Before diving into the recipes, it’s essential to understand the different types of tequila. Tequila is made from the blue agave plant and is primarily produced in the state of Jalisco, Mexico. There are several types of tequila, each with its unique characteristics:

  • Blanco (Silver): Unaged or aged for less than two months. It has a clean, crisp flavor.
  • Reposado: Aged between two months and one year. It has a smoother, more mellow flavor.
  • Añejo: Aged between one and three years. It has a richer, more complex flavor.
  • Extra Añejo: Aged for more than three years. It has a very rich and complex flavor.

Classic Margarita

The margarita is perhaps the most famous tequila cocktail. This classic recipe is simple yet delicious.

  • 2 oz tequila (blanco or reposado)
  • 1 oz fresh lime juice
  • 0.5 oz agave syrup
  • Salt for rimming the glass (optional)

Instructions:

  1. Rim a glass with salt (if using).
  2. Combine tequila, lime juice, and agave syrup in a shaker with ice.
  3. Shake well and strain into the prepared glass filled with ice.
  4. Garnish with a lime wheel.

🍹 Note: For a frozen margarita, blend all ingredients with ice until smooth.

Paloma

The paloma is a refreshing and tangy cocktail that pairs tequila with grapefruit soda.

  • 2 oz tequila (blanco or reposado)
  • 0.5 oz fresh lime juice
  • Grapefruit soda (such as Squirt or Jarritos)
  • Lime wheel for garnish

Instructions:

  1. Fill a glass with ice.
  2. Add tequila and lime juice.
  3. Top with grapefruit soda and stir gently.
  4. Garnish with a lime wheel.

Tequila Sunrise

The tequila sunrise is a visually stunning cocktail with a beautiful gradient of colors.

  • 2 oz tequila (blanco or reposado)
  • 4 oz orange juice
  • 0.5 oz grenadine
  • Orange slice and cherry for garnish

Instructions:

  1. Fill a glass with ice.
  2. Add tequila and orange juice.
  3. Gently pour grenadine down the side of the glass.
  4. Garnish with an orange slice and cherry.

Tequila Mojito

The tequila mojito is a refreshing twist on the classic mojito, using tequila instead of rum.

  • 2 oz tequila (blanco or reposado)
  • 1 oz fresh lime juice
  • 0.75 oz simple syrup
  • 8-10 fresh mint leaves
  • Club soda
  • Mint sprig for garnish

Instructions:

  1. In a glass, muddle the mint leaves.
  2. Add tequila, lime juice, and simple syrup.
  3. Fill the glass with ice and top with club soda.
  4. Stir gently and garnish with a mint sprig.
